However, strategic use requires knowing what not to do. While Gifters is excellent for short headlines and decorative titles, it is not suitable for long copy or dense information. Trying to write a paragraph of body text in a blackletter font is a recipe for reader fatigue. The intricate strokes can make the text hard to scan, especially on mobile screens where users are skimming quickly. For supporting typography, it is best to pair Gifters with a clean sans serif font or a modern typography system that offers high readability.

We found that pairing Gifters with a minimalist sans serif created a striking balance. The bold, gothic nature of the header drew the user in, while the clean secondary text delivered the necessary details clearly. This approach ensured message clarity without sacrificing style. Optimizing for Digital Visibility

When integrating Gifters into your workflow, consider the environment where your content will live. On image overlays, ensure there is enough contrast between the text and the background. Dark backgrounds work exceptionally well with the blackletter style, enhancing the gothic mood, while light backgrounds require careful spacing to prevent the letters from blending together. For web design, use Gifters sparingly. It is ideal for hero sections or feature boxes where you want to make a statement, but avoid using it for navigation menus or footer links.

Readability also depends on the medium. For Pinterest pins, which are often viewed vertically on mobile devices, keep the text large and centered. The font's verticality complements the pin format well. Similarly, for reels covers, a bold application of Gifters ensures that viewers know exactly what the video is about before they even click play. Just remember that fast-scrolling feeds demand immediate impact. If your message takes too long to decode, the user will move on. Gifters provides that immediate impact, but only if the message itself is concise.

There are scenarios where this font might not be the right choice. Formal corporate communication, legal disclaimers, or any situation requiring a neutral tone should steer clear of this typeface. Its strong personality can sometimes overshadow the message, making it unsuitable for serious announcements. Instead, reserve Gifters for creative projects, seasonal sales, and campaigns where emotion and atmosphere are key drivers of engagement.
